NOV 4th & 5th PRACTICE - 11/2/2006
Looks like we might be able to squeeze in a couple of more weekends of practice before the ground freezes up. The weather outlook is good for this weekend with temps forecast in high 40's. No rain!
$25.00
Track opens at 10am and I'm thinking of getting there around 10:30/11am. It's off exit 32 on Route 95 in Maine, so 32 miles past the Maine border. Took me two hours to get there from Quincy MA.

I rode MX207 a few weeks back. I really enjoyed the track. Was a long, fun, track with a mix of everything. Little bit of a sand section, but nothing like Crow Hill's,. These were shorter and easier to deal with. Some big straights where you can really get the bike opened up as well. There is a nice mix of jumps including a few stepups (fun!), a 4-pack rythem section, 100' long tabletop (so you can basically just jump as far as you can), and a 40' hip/double which is the 'hardest' jump there. Also the back straights develops whoops, but there is also a legit whoop section that is pretty mint for dialing them in.
Along with the big track there is a pitbike / beginner track that is also pretty sharp. You can see it in the 2nd pic below, it's the light coloured track inside of the main track.
